# SinricPro Python SDK

Official Python SDK for [SinricPro](https://sinric.pro) - Control your IoT devices with Alexa and Google Home.

## Supported Devices

**Lighting & Switches:**
- Smart Switch - On/Off control
- Smart Light - RGB color, brightness, color temperature
- Dimmable Switch - On/Off with brightness control

**Sensors:**
- Motion Sensor - Detect movement
- Contact Sensor - Door/window open/closed detection
- Temperature Sensor - Temperature and humidity monitoring
- Air Quality Sensor - PM1.0, PM2.5, PM10 measurements
- Power Sensor - Voltage, current, power monitoring

**Control Devices:**
- Blinds - Position control (0-100%)
- Garage Door - Open/close control
- Smart Lock - Lock/unlock control

**Climate Control:**
- Thermostat - Temperature control with modes (AUTO, COOL, HEAT, ECO)
- Window AC - Air conditioning control

**Other Devices:**
- Fan - On/Off control
- Doorbell - Doorbell press events

## Logging

Enable debug logging to see detailed information:

```python
from sinricpro import SinricProLogger, LogLevel

# Set log level
SinricProLogger.set_level(LogLevel.DEBUG)
```

Available log levels: `DEBUG`, `INFO`, `WARN`, `ERROR`, `NONE`

## Troubleshooting

### Connection Issues

1. **Check credentials** - Ensure APP_KEY and APP_SECRET are correct
2. **Check device ID** - Verify the device ID is exactly 24 hexadecimal characters
3. **Check network** - Ensure you have internet connectivity
4. **Enable debug logging** - Set `debug=True` in config to see detailed logs

### Common Errors

**"Invalid app_key format"**
- App key must be a valid UUID (xxxxxxxx-xxxx-xxxx-xxxx-xxxxxxxxxxxx)

**"Invalid app_secret: must be at least 32 characters"**
- App secret must be at least 32 characters long

**"Invalid device_id format"**
- Device ID must be exactly 24 hexadecimal characters
